Understanding the Conversion Process

Before we dive into the steps, it's essential to understand the conversion process. The metric system and the imperial system have different units for measurements. In the metric system, we use centimeters (cm) for length, while in the imperial system, we use feet (ft) for the same measurement. To convert 183cm to ft, we need to divide the length in centimeters by 30.48, as there are 30.48 centimeters in one foot.

However, to make this conversion easier, you can also use a conversion factor. This factor is 1 foot = 30.48 centimeters. So, when converting 183cm to ft, we can simply divide 183 by 30.48 to get the equivalent length in feet.
